Abstract
This application discloses a kind of gap filler for building, be made up of following component by mass fraction, epoxy resin 50 parts, Ethylene glycol diglycidyl ether 30 parts, aerosil 10 parts, Pulvis Talci 30 parts, the Meng alkane diamidogen 30 parts, diaminourea cyclohexylamine 15 parts, sodium polyacrylate 15 parts, shoddy 20 parts.Thus, gap filler possesses the most ageing-resistant, waterproof and pressure performance, is also equipped with insulation effect, and fire-proof sound insulation is effective, and reduces integrated cost.
